Hailed as the epitome of beauty by millions around the world, Bella Hadid, who is also an inspiration to countless aspiring models, collapsed in her latest Instagram post. Sharing a few tearful selfies, the model captioned the post with a long heartbreaking note about her mental health issues. The American model, who has previously spoken about depression and anxiety, even shared a video of Hollywood actor Will Smith’s daughter Willow Smith with her selfies. “Willow Smith, I love you and your words. It made me feel a little less alone and that’s why I would love to post this,” Bella wrote.

The 25-year-old model opened up about anxiety and overcoming flaws together while slamming “social media” into her post. She even wrote: “Social media is not real. For anyone who is struggling, please remember this. Sometimes all you need to hear is that you are not alone. So from me to you, you are not alone. I love you, I see you and I hear you. “

Further, speaking about her mental health issues, Bella added, “It took me a long time to figure this out, but I’ve had enough depression and exhaustion to know this: if you work hard enough on it. yourself, spend time alone to understand your traumas, your triggers, your joys and your routine, you will always be able to understand or learn more about your own pain and how to deal with it. you may be wondering. Anyway. I don’t know why but it feels harder and harder not to share my truth here. Thank you for seeing me and thank you for listening to me. I love you . “

Needless to say, Bella’s Instagram post went viral in no time, leaving her fans in awe. While many came out in favor of the model, Bella’s post was called “bogus” by many Twitter users. Here are some reactions:

Bella’s sister Gigi Hadid, who recently split from partner Zayn Malik, has provided support. Singer Willow Smith, who was mentioned in the post, also replied, “Your honesty and tenderness heals so much” in the comments section. Meanwhile, Bella, who took a hiatus from social media earlier this year to focus and improve her mental health, gave everyone a glimpse of her battle with her post.
